    You use the Kona 2 720p 8 or 10 bits uncompressed mode or the Kona 2 DVCPRO HD mode. The only thing that matters is that the footage is shot at 25fps and that the capture mode is also 25 fps. The Kona then knows ot has to throw away the duplicate frames. I’m not sure about the AJ 1200. I don’t think you have to choose 50 or 60 Hz. That has no relevance as far as I know. The playback speed remains 59.94 fps.

    Here are the steps to create a 720p 25 easy setup.

    1) Setup FCP with a Kona 2 720p 23.98 easy setup.
    a) Go to Easy setup menu ( ).
    b) Make sure the SHOW ALL checkbox is checked.
    c) Select one if the Kona 2 720p 23.98 easy setups (uncompressed or
    DVCpro HD – your choice).
    2) Create a varicam 720p 25 capture preset.
    a) Go to FCP audio video settings -> capture presets (tab).
    b) Click on : Automatically makes a copy and puts you in
    the preset editor.
    c) Rename capture preset to Kona 2 varicam 720p 25.
    d) Change FPS from 23.98 to 25.
    e) Exit.
    3) Create a varicam 720p 25 sequence preset.
    a) Go to FCP audio video settings -> sequence presets (tab).
    b) Click on
    : Automatically makes a copy and puts you in
    the preset editor.
    c) Rename sequence preset to varicam 720p 25.
    d) Change FPS from 23.98 to 25.
    e) Exit.
    4) Go to FCP audio video settings -> Summary and click on . Name it Kona varicam 720p 25 “codec name”. This easy setup is based
    on the new capture preset and sequence preset you created in steps 2 and 3.
    Note: playback remains at 720p 59.94.

    Got it from Rudy from AJA.. Also take a look in the FAQ in the AJA website on the Kona 2 support page
